Second Half Run Pushes Mavericks over Mounties

Buffalo, NY - The Mount Aloysius men's basketball team was tied 36-36 with host Medaille College with under 14 minutes remaining, but a late run by the Mavericks pushed them past the Mounties by a final score of 71-58 on Saturday afternoon in conference action.

After going into halftime tied 27-27, the Mounties continued their strong play on the road and were tied with the Mavericks at 36-36 when Tommy Pisula hit a layup with 14:40 to go in the second half. The Mavericks then went on a decisive 16-3 run over the next five minutes to lead 52-39 before Julian Stover hit a three-point shot with 8:28 to go to cut the deficit to 10 points. However, the Mounties weren't able to cut the Maverick lead any further as the home side marched to the victory.

Stover scored 13 points and added five rebounds for Mount Aloysius, while Pisula added nine points, six rebounds and two steals. David Swatsworth contributed eight points and seven rebounds, and Shaire Tolson-Ford registered nine points, four rebounds and three assists off the bench. 

The Mounties drop to 5-11 in conference play but still hold a one-game lead over Pitt-Greensburg and Franciscan for the sixth and final playoff spot in the AMCC standings with two games left. Mount Aloysius will travel to Franciscan on Wednesday for a crucial conference matchup at 6 p.m. The Mounties could clinch a playoff berth with a win on Wednesday combined with a Pitt-Greensburg loss to La Roche.
